**About Us**:
Western Continuing Studies (WCS) is the educational bridge between Western University and the global community, from its downtown location in London to its satellite campuses in Trois-Pistoles and Rimouski, Quebec. Through innovative leadership in lifelong learning, WCS creates and delivers responsive and accessible programs, including non-credit and credit courses in public interest, post-degree diplomas, French immersion, experiential learning, corporate training and Western eLearn. In partnerships with faculties, employers and professional associations, the unit reflects the academic mandate and vision of the University and its vision, mission, mandate and operating principles are integrated with those of the institution.

**Responsibilities**:
The Program Manager has direct accountability for the development, maintenance and delivery of a large and complex portfolio of professional development, personal enrichment and corporate training programs, and is accountable for meeting financial targets in a cost recovery/ profit generating model. The Program Manager is responsible for the overall quality of programs and for the leadership and direct supervision of staff and instructors supporting the portfolio.
Through regular contact with employers, professional associations and community partners and stakeholders, the Program Manager researches and identifies opportunities for new course and program initiatives, and ensures development and delivery by industry experts using innovative technologies. The Program Manager is responsible for fostering and maintaining effective partnerships with internal and external stakeholders.
